Zespół systemu operacyjnego Syllable dokonał implementacji dwóch ważnych mechanizmów: asynchronicznej obsługi wejścia-wyjścia oraz mapowania pamięci (mmap). Oba zostały napisane jako rdzenne POSIX-owe wywołania na poziomie jądra.
Asynchroniczne I/O było dotąd przechwytywane przez libc, które w rzeczywistości...Technologie
Wyjątkowo długo trwało czekanie na nową wersję Syllable, ale w końcu jest. W wersji 0.6.6 znajdziemy przede wszystkim nową przeglądarkę Webster (wykorzystującą silnik WebKit) oraz obsługę QEMU, dzięki której pod Syllable można uruchamiać inne systemy operacyjne.
W nowym wydaniu systemu pojawiła się także -- na...Technologie
No, prawie :). Michael Saunders zainstalował system operacyjny Syllable na subnotebooku Asus Eee PC. Działa większość funkcji laptopa, oprócz panoramicznego wideo oraz... sieci. Zespół Syllable mimo to planuje wydanie specjalnej wersji systemu dla Eee PC.
Syllable na Asusie
Udało się natomiast uzyskać w pełni działające:...Technologie
Norman Deppenbroek sportował NewLisp -- wariant języka programowania Lisp -- dla systemu operacyjnego Syllable. Oprócz tego Syllable otrzymało nowe wersje języków Objective Caml (3.10.2) oraz Perl (5.10.0).
Kelly'emu Wilsonowi udało się uzyskać wsparcie dla PThreads w OCamlu. Perl jest natomiast lepiej dostosowany do struktury...Technologie
Jest już nowe wydanie wolnego systemu operacyjnego (na GNU GPL), Syllable 0.6.5. Jest to główna, biurkowa linia systemu. Od niedawna rozwijana jest także linia serwerowa na jądrze Linux (najnowsza wersja Syllable Server nosi numer 0.2), dlatego Syllable Desktop 0.6.5 zawiera nieco poprawek związanych z harmonizacją rozwoju obu...Technologie
14 grudnia pojawiło się drugie wydanie Syllable Server oznaczone wersją 0.2, który od początku tworzony jest jako lekka platforma wirtualizacyjna do uruchamiania innych systemów operacyjnych (lub wielu instancji samego siebie), zawiera QEmu i zintegrowany z systemem moduł dla jądra akcelerujący je.
Sam system udostępnia...